Liverpool simply cannot keep centre-halves fit.

Martin Skrtel has re-injured himself, and now Dejan Lovren could miss matches after limping off the field after 11 minutes today against Sunderland.

There was seemingly no collision for Lovren, but Jurgen Klopp had to bring on Kolo Toure early on in the Croat’s place.

Lovren had only just returned from a hamstring injury picked up in the first-leg of the League Cup semi-final, so the issue could potentially be a recurrence of that problem.

We’ll have to wait of course until word from the club regarding the seriousness of the issue, but with Skrtel out for three more week – it might now be Steven Caulker’s chance to get a continued run in the side.
